    Originally from New Jersey, Warren is a Co-Founder of Toasted Life, an entertainment, lifestyle, and leisure brand that cultivates community and champions celebration through dynamic events and experiences. Since their founding in 2013, they've been the pre-eminent events brand for people of color in the Bay Area, and have since expanded globally, hosting activations across the US, as well as in Toronto, Tanzania, and Ghana. They've collaborated with the likes of Common, Terrence J, Jidenna, Wyclef Jean, T Pain, Pusha-T, Estelle, 2 Chainz, DJ Envy, and Metro Boomin just to name a few.

    A native of San Jose, California, Adam is a designer in the truest sense of the word. Currently a Designer & Fellow at The Institute of Black Imagination, he merges his interests in cognitive science, sustainability, and technology to solve problems that matter. In his time as a cognitive science student at UC Berkeley, he served as a Design fellow at the 1881 Institute of Technology, an Applications Engineering Intern at Carbon, which is responsible for projects like the FutureCraft sneaker with Adidas, and as a venture capitalist at not one, but two venture capital firms.

    All of these accomplishments were on top of him maintaining a rigorous course load, being President of the Unmanned Autonomous Vehicles Club, being a former member of the varsity track team, and finding time to still have fun. Outside of work, Adam delves into creative passion projects, creating concepts for innovative sneaker designs and virtual fashion shows, and dabbling in photography.

    Growing up just a few minutes West of Chicago, Quinnton is a co-founder & CEO of Retrospect Studios, a Black-owned experimental studio focused on connecting history and culture with creative and technology solutions to enhance the human experience. Based out of Brooklyn, NY, he is passionate about leading teams and developing creative talent. He specializes in building compelling and authentic brand experiences for companies and entrepreneurs.

    A graduate of MIT, Quinnton's has excelled amongst the best of the best, serving as an Art Director at Digitas, Lead Creative for recently Procter & Gamble acquired Walker & Company Brands (makers of the brand Bevel), inaugural Creative Director at Blavity, and Group Creative Director & Global Lead of Computational Design at Publicis Sapient.

    Outside of work, creative expression always finds its way to Quinnton's atmosphere. Whether he is creative directing photoshoots, organizing nature walks with his friends, or inspiring creativity & diversity through collectives like KOR and HellaCreative, Quinnton's impact is both broad and deep.

    A native of New Hampshire with family roots in Trinidad and Tobego, Jonathan is a true lover of learning, growth, and personal development. A writer, speaker, entrepreneur, cultural historian, and lover of all things Dipset, Jonathan has merged his interests in culture, media, social impact, and technology to create at the highest levels.

    Since graduating from Washington University in St. Louis with a degree in Political Science, Jonathan has served as program manager and editor for LinkedIn's Influencer Program, Co-Founder and Head of Corporate Brand at Blavity, the largest media and lifestyle brand for Black millennials, Editor in Chief for Red Table Talk Enterprises, External Advisory Council for Nielson, and a joint fellow at both the Nieman Foundation for Journalism and Berkman Klein Center for Internet & Society at Harvard University, where he explored frameworks to measure black cultural influence in the world.

    More than these accomplishments, what impresses people the most about Jonathan is that he's as motivated to unpack the foundations of his ego and perspective throughout his journey, as he is to unpack the biggest questions that guide his work.
